Description
Misplaced Eternity" is a profound work by Tijuana Smith, inspired by her deep Christian faith and the harrowing experience of losing eight family members in just seven months. The book delves into Smith's personal journey of wrestling with immense grief and seeking answers from God about death and suffering. It's a candid exploration of the natural despair felt in the face of loss that encourages readers to bring their hardest questions to God. In this book, Smith candidly shares her struggles coping with the immense pain and confusion that accompany significant loss. She openly discusses how this period of her life led her to confront difficult questions about death, suffering, and God's role in the hardships we face. Smith doesn't shy away from the complexity of these emotions and questions. Instead, she invites readers to join her on this journey of exploration. She uses her personal experiences as a framework to delve into biblical scripture, seeking not just comfort but also understanding and context for her pain. Additionally, "Misplaced Eternity" is enriched with personal anecdotes that offer glimpses into Smith's life and her process of healing and acceptance. These stories add a deeply human touch to the book, making it relatable and authentic.
About the author
Tijuana Smith, an accomplished accountant and real estate investor, never considered writing a book as part of her life's aspirations. Her packed schedule left little room for creative pursuits. However, after experiencing a series of grievous losses, she felt compelled to share her journey with others. Tijuana saw writing as a way to process her pain, find hope and healing and connect with others who may be going through similar experiences. Tijuana has been married to her husband Roy for nearly 32 years and they are the proud parents of two adult children. In her leisure time, Tijuana cherishes moments of peace basking in the sun on a beach, curling up with a good book, spending quality time with loved ones, and offering a helping hand to those in need.
